#2f8708 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f8708 is composed of 18.4% red, 52.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 101.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 28%. #2f8708 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ff10 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#2f8708 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f8708 has RGB values of R:47, G:135,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3114760.

Shades and Tints of #2f8708
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f6f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f8708
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464b45 is the less saturated color, while #2d8d02 is the most saturated one.
